Stability Analysis of 2# Coal Seam in Xingdong Coal Mine with the Roadway Filling Mining Method

Abstract: Based on mining characteristics of roadway mining and filling of 2# coal seam in Xingdong Coalmine,the three-dimensional numerical model was built by using FLAC3D numerical analysis software to simulate the process of coal seam mining,supporting and waste filling.By using this model,the variety of the upper settlement,plastic area and vertical stress field under two conditions are studied:the first scheme(roadways were anchored without filling) and the second scheme(roadways were anchored and filled).The results shows that,waste filling body can improve the bearing capacity of coal pillar by applying lateral stress to coal pillar,but also decrease the upper settlement and the plastic area,and control the value of vertical stress.

Key words: Roadway-pillar mining, Waste filling, Numerical simulation, Stability analysis
